Kawhi Leonard wants out of San Antonio and would prefer to be traded to the Lakers, according to Chris Haynes and Adrian Wojnarowski of ESPN.

Shams Charania of Yahoo Sports is reporting the same info. It's clear that Kawhi and his camp wanted to make sure they got their point across. Per Shams, "Leonard has grown uncomfortable with the Spurs and is ready for a move." Leonard, who only appeared in nine games last season due to a debilitating quad injury and can opt out of his contract next summer, was reportedly set to meet with Gregg Popovich in New York this week. We can expect plenty of developments between now and the draft, but it appears Leonard may have played his last game as a Spur.
